2 Asphalt roof shingles are the most common roof products in America due to the fact that they work in all environmental conditions - roofing companies garden city ks. Quality differs widely, so ask whether your tiles pass the ASTM D3161, Course F (110 mph) or ASTM D7158, Course H (150 miles per hour) wind examinations and are ranked class 3 or 4 influence score
Nevertheless, steel can be noisy throughout rainstorms. 5Find out more concerning the advantages and disadvantages of steel roofs. Steel roof coverings differ in top quality of material and cost. Usually, a steel roof covering can set you back anywhere from $9,750-42,750.6 Interlocking tiles resemble slate, clay or roof shingles and withstand damages triggered by heavy rains (as much as 8.8 inches per hour), winds of 120 miles per hour, enjoyable, hail and freeze-thaw cycles.
7 Rock layered steel is thought about a more economic choice when it concerns roof covering, with a per square foot price of $5.40-10.37.7 Slate roof covering can last even more than 100 years. It won't shed, is waterproof and stands up to mold and mildew and fungi. Slate works in damp climates but is pricey, heavy and might be quickly damaged when stepped on.
